On 08/04/2015 12:40 PM, Stephen Leake wrote:

> It would help if the header comment in project.el said something along
> those lines.
>
> There is a big difference between:
>
> "provide an interface between projects and the rest of Emacs"
>
> and
>
> "provide a core API for implementing projects".
>
> The current project.el header is unclear as to which it is intended to
> be.

Would adding this help?

diff --git a/lisp/progmodes/project.el b/lisp/progmodes/project.el
index d849f93..16578f1 100644
--- a/lisp/progmodes/project.el
+++ b/lisp/progmodes/project.el
@@ -22,6 +22,10 @@
  ;; This file contains generic infrastructure for dealing with
  ;; projects, and a number of public functions: finding the current
  ;; root, related project directories, search path, etc.
+;;
+;; The goal is to make it easy for Lisp programs to operate on the
+;; current project, without having to know which package handles
+;; detection of that project type, parsing its config files, etc.

  ;;; Code:

> If it's really the former, that puts a much different light on things;
> it should be providing wrappers/adaptors for EDE, projectile, etc, so
> grep, compile etc can use project information.

"Should" is a strong word. There's wrapper for EDE living in 
lisp/cedet/ede.el already. Projectile "should" include its own wrapper 
as well.

> In particular, there should be no "xref-find-regexp"; instead, "grep"
> and similar commands should be enhanced to optionally use project
> functions to get the search path.

xref-find-regexp can still be useful: it'll search a user-specified 
directory and present the results using the xref interface.

At the moment, xref-find-regexp offers both types of searches. To search 
in an arbitrary directory, you preface it with C-u.
